Abstract

Die Erfindung betrifft eine Vorrichtung zur Messung der vertikalen Position von einem drehbar angetriebenen Rotor (12) einer Rundläufer-Tablettenpresse paarweise zugeordneten und synchron mit dem Rotor (12) rotierenden Ober- und Unterstempeln (18,20), die während einer Rotorumdrehung in bestimmten Bereichen entlang des Umfangs ihrer Drehbewegung eine vertikale Bewegung ausführen. Die Vorrichtung weist mindestens einen an mindestens einem der Ober- und/oder Unterstempel (18,20) angeordneten, parallel zur vertikalen Bewegungsrichtung des jeweiligen Ober- und/oder Unterstempels (18,20) verlaufenden Maßstab (54), und mindestens eine dem Maßstab (54) zugeordnete, ebenfalls synchron mit dem Rotor (12) rotierende Leseneinrichtung (56) auf, mit der eine vertikale Position des jeweiligen Ober- und/oder Unterstempels (18,20) durch Auslesen des Maßstabs (54) messbar ist. Die Erfindung betrifft außerdem eine entsprechende Rundläufer-Tablettenpresse und ein entsprechendes Verfahren.
